ABOUT WEST GIPPSLAND ARTS CENTRE


West Gippsland Arts Centre has been servicing the Gippsland community since July 1982.


The Centre enjoys pride of place in the beautifully landscaped Civic Precinct and is the region's major performing arts, cultural and community centre catering to a wide variety of events, meetings, conferences and festivals.

Brief History:

The Centre was a project funded jointly by the then Shire of Warragul and the Victorian State Government. It started its life in the early 1970's as a vision shared by a small group of locals who, through relentless determination, brought the many players to the table to eventually see funding made available for their great vision - West Gippsland′s own Performing Arts Centre.

West Gippsland Arts Centre is a service of Baw Baw Shire
Council and is supported by Creative Victoria through their
Regional Partnerships Funding Program.
